Overview
- lesbians’diverse expressions and understandings of beauty
- the gender of a bisexual woman’s partner and how it impacts her beauty routines and self-image
- beauty standards of older lesbians and how their views on the qualities of potential partners and on their own partners change as they age
- the beauty standards of lesbian and bisexual women of color
- pressures on lesbians to be thin and how this affects their feelings about their bodies and themselves
- feminism and its potential role in protecting women from eating disorders and negative body imagePersonal, intelligent, and informative, Lesbians, Levis, and Lipstick gives you insight into the meanings of lesbian beauty. Emphasizing strength, confidence, and self-acceptance as attractive qualities, this uplifting book will help you realize your own beauty and give you a new freedom to experiment with fresh expressions of it.
This book title, Lesbians, Levis, and Lipstick (The Meaning of Beauty in Our Lives), ISBN: 9781560231219, by Joanie Erickson, Jeanine Cogan, published by Taylor & Francis (July 9, 1999) is available in paperback.
